Title: The Innovative Contributions of Daniel T. Lagoe
Introduction
Daniel T. Lagoe is a notable inventor based in St. Louis, MO, who has made significant contributions to the field of medical devices. With a total of five patents to his name, Lagoe has focused on developing innovative solutions that enhance medical procedures and patient care.
Latest Patents
One of Lagoe's latest patents is a device and method for removing material from a hollow anatomical structure. This medical device is designed to efficiently remove material from hollow anatomical structures. The device includes a shaft member and an expandable centering element located near the distal end. Additionally, it features a macerator element that can be either attached to the shaft or independently movable. The device may also incorporate a rotating wire connected to the macerator element. An aspiration lumen is included for the removal of material, and a drive shaft connected to a motor is used to rotate the macerator element. This device can be utilized in conjunction with a distal occlusion element, which may be a radially expandable filter or a balloon member.
